WebJul 11, 2024 · Adding line numbers to the grep output is straight forward – you just need to include the -n option in the grep command. For example: grep -n location variables.tf 11 :variable "location" { This time the output has included the line number, in this case line 11. Note the -n is a short way of using --line-number

From man grep: -n, --line-number Prefix each line of output with the 1-based line number within its input file.
